Over the course of 4 weeks, students ages 7-12 will join us in our Mar Vista and Echo Park writing labs for "English Language Learner Camp" to work on their English language skills and become confident writers, enthusiastic readers, and strong communicators.

Each week's activities and writing will be based on themes, including food, arts and culture, science, nature, and time travel. Students will work in small groups with amazing volunteers like you. At the end of the camp, each student and volunteer will leave with their very own published compendium of student-written stories.

While this program is designed for students classified as English language learners level 3 and below, no Spanish language skills and no experience working with English language learners necessary.

We'll have two sessions per day (a morning session 10:30AM-1PM and an afternoon session 3-5:30PM), Mondays through Thursdays at both our Mar Vista and Echo Park locations.

Mission Statement

826LA is a non-profit organization dedicated to supporting students ages 6 to 18 with their creative and expository writing skills, and to helping teachers inspire their students to write. Our services are structured around the understanding that great leaps in learning can happen with one-on-one attention, and that strong writing skills are fundamental to future success. With this in mind, we provide after school tutoring, reading and creative writing workshops, in-schools projects, and field trips! All of our programs are challenging and enjoyable, and ultimately strengthen each student's power to express ideas effectively, creatively, confidently, and in their individual voice. We have two brick and mortars in Mar Vista and Echo Park, as well as three Writers Rooms at Roosevelt High School, at Manual Arts High School, and at Venice High School.
